Claims
- 1. A gasket having a uniform thickness portion and multiple regions of different densities within the uniform thickness portion comprising:
- a first lamina of a gasket material;
- a second lamina of a gasket material, said second lamina being disposed in partial overlapping relationship with said first lamina;
- a perforated core having a plurality of prongs formed thereon, said prongs extending from a first side of said core into said first and second laminae so as to form a unitary gasket having a uniform thickness portion, said uniform thickness portion including a first density region defined by that portion of the first lamina which is overlapped by the second lamina and a second density region defined by that portion of the first lamina which is not overlapped by the second lamina.
- 2. The invention defined in claim 1 further including third and fourth laminae of gasket material, said fourth lamina being disposed in partial overlapping relationship with said third lamina, and wherein a plurality of prongs extend from a second side of said core into said third and fourth laminae so as to form said unitary gasket.
- 3. A gasket having a uniform thickness portion and multiple regions of different densities within the uniform thickness portion comprising:
- a first lamina of a gasket material having a first shape;
- a second lamina of a gasket material having a second shape different from said first shape, said first and second laminae being disposed in overlapping relationship;
- a perforated core having a plurality of prongs formed thereon, said prongs extending from a first side of said core into said first and second laminae to combine together into a unitary gasket having a uniform thickness portion including a first density region defined by that portion of the first lamina which is overlapped by the second lamina and a second density region defined by that portion of the first lamina which is not overlapped by the second lamina.
